Weight Lifting Simulator mimics real-world resistance training through an interactive 3D interface. Users select exercises such as cleans, snatches, squats, and presses, then receive dynamic visual feedback on posture, joint angles, and movement patterns. The system layers real-time biomechanical data—offering insights into alignment, load distribution, and effort efficiency—without physical weights. Its design prioritizes user education, translating complex strength concepts into digestible, visual cues that support proper technique and safer progressions.
Common Questions About Weight Lifting Simulator
How accurate is the biomechanical feedback?
The simulator uses validated movement models grounded in sports science, providing reliable posture and alignment guidance tailored to real strength training mechanics.
Can this replace working out with actual equipment?
No—Weight Lifting Simulator complements physical training by strengthening motor memory and technique awareness, but it is best used alongside real-world workouts.
